On Sun, 21 Feb 2010 21:40:33 +0100, Sebastian Kügler <sebas@kde.org> wrote:

> Actually, it's not only his time, but might lead to misconfiguration  
> which might lead
> to security problems. People forgetting to set it to lock for one, but  
> not for the
> other (and then, weeks later suspend to disk while they used to suspend  
> to RAM --
> it's easy to confuse those two, I guess most users are not able to tell  
> the
> difference) and the machine is not locked while it should be.
>
> Security settings have to be as simple as possible, otherwise they're  
> not effective.
> For that reason, I'd prefer to not make it an option, too.

Thank you for explaining me this.
I must admit, you've got a point. Indeed it could lead to security  
problems which weights more that just the comfort.

After all, I just thought it would be a nice feature and shouldn't be too  
hard to implement. I didn't think about any consequences though.
